BICH 409 Final Exam 1 Test Questions
with All Correct Answers 2025-2026
Updated.
isolated system - Answer no exchange of energy or matter (thermos, ice chest)



closed system - Answer only energy is allowed to be exchanged (chicken egg, unopened
soda, stoppered reaction flask)



open system - Answer both energy and matter are allowed to exchange

(human, cell, open reaction flask, opened soda)



what is the only way to change internal energy in a closed system? - Answer heat or work



first law of thermodynamics - Answer the energy of the universe is conserved. it can neither
be created nor destroyed



heat (q) - Answer random thermal motion



what does +q signify - Answer heat added to the system from the surroundings



what does -q signify - Answer heat is given up from the system to the surroundings



work (w) - Answer organized motion

includes:

- pressure/volume

- mechanical

- electrical

- magnetic

- chemical



what does +w signify - Answer work done by the system on the surroundings. system loses
energy



what does -w signify - Answer work done on the system by the surroundings. system gains
energy

,expression for first law: - Answer deltaE = q - w



what are examples of state functions and how are they denoted - Answer denoted by capital
letter, includes internal energy, volume, pressure, temperature, enthalpy, entropy, free energy,
equilibrium constants, and electrical potentials



what does the value of non state functions depend on - Answer the pathway used to go from
the initial state to the final state.



what are examples of non state functions and how are they denoted - Answer denoted by
lowercase letters, examples are heat, work, and velocity



what does change of internal energy of a system depend on? - Answer initial and final state,
not the path



enthalpy (H) - Answer the heat content of the system



enthalpy equation - Answer deltaH = deltaE + delta(PV)



enthalpy equation at constant pressure - Answer deltaH = q



deltaH > 0 (positive) - Answer endothermic (heat energy put into the system)



deltaH < 0 (negative) - Answer exothermic (heat energy is given off by the system)



entropy (S) - Answer the degree of disorder of a system



what increases vs decreases entropy of a system - Answer increase: anything that increases
disorder or randomness

decrease: anything that organizes or orders



second law of thermodynamics - Answer all spontaneous processes proceed from an
ordered to disordered state. all spontaneous processes increase the entropy of the universe.



free energy - Answer maximum amount of work that can be obtained at constant
temperature and pressure

, Gibbs Free Energy equation - Answer deltaG = deltaH - T(deltaS)



deltaG < 0 (negative) - Answer exergonic (spontaneous)



deltaG > 0 (positive) - Answer endergonic (nonspontaneous)



deltaG = 0 - Answer equilibrium



positive deltaS means: - Answer enthalpically opposed

entropically driven



negative deltaS means: - Answer entropically opposed

enthalpically driven



sign of deltaG - Answer direction process proceeds



magnitude of deltaG - Answer how far process must proceed until equilibrium



equilibrium - Answer state of minimum potential energy.

all naturally occurring processes proceed towards equilibrium



any process with a nonzero deltaG will proceed __________ - Answer spontaneously
towards equilibrium



deltaG = - Answer -(R)(T)(lnKeq) + (R)(T)ln([C][D]/[A][B])



gas constant, R = - Answer 8.3145 J/molK



biochemist standard state - Answer concentration of all reactants and products is 1M

pH is 7, or [H+] = 10-7M

pressure is 1atm

temperature is 298K

H2O concentration is 55M
